Location
Located in the very heart of Sudbury, the 3-star Days Inn By Wyndham Sudbury & Conference Centre offers air-conditioned rooms, 3.2 km from Dynamic Earth Interactive Museum. Offering a location in proximity to the Sudbury Arena, the inn overlooks city and has an American-style restaurant.
The centre of Sudbury can be reached within a 15-minute walk. The Days Inn By Wyndham Sudbury & Conference Centre is also 10 minutes by car from Science North in Sudbury. Guests might as well enjoy proximity to Tom Davies Square, situated 550 metres away. The Art Gallery of Sudbury is 17 minutes' walk away. The nearest bus stop is Douglas 250 metres away.
Along with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, the renovated rooms offer coffee and tea making facilities, and a microwave, and private bathrooms with a walk-in shower and a separate toilet. The bedrooms come with pillowtop beds. Bathrooms, equipped with a separate toilet and a shower/bath combination, also feature hair dryers and shower caps.
Days Inn By Wyndham Sudbury & Conference Centre features a hot continental breakfast. Eagle Olive Inc restaurant at this Sudbury hotel serves Italian specialities. Guests are invited to the onsite lounge bar to unwind with a drink. You can visit a restaurant situated close by and taste Canadian cuisine.
